Complementary Colors

Blue With Grey

Grey and blue make an elegant and sophisticated combination. Navy blue, in particular, creates a timeless and classic look when paired with different shades of grey. Lighter shades of blue, such as baby blue or sky blue, can also complement lighter grey tones, adding a touch of freshness to your outfit.

Pink With Grey

Pink and grey create a subtle and feminine pairing. Light shades of pink, like blush or pastel pink, can soften the coolness of grey and create a delicate and romantic vibe. For a bolder statement, you can opt for vibrant shades of pink, such as fuchsia or magenta, to create a striking contrast with grey. Burgundy With Grey

For a more sophisticated and rich look, burgundy is an excellent choice with grey. The deep, warm tones of burgundy add depth and intensity to grey clothing, making it suitable for formal and casual occasions. A burgundy blazer or accessories can instantly elevate a grey ensemble and create a stylish and refined appearance.

Analogous Colors

Neutrals

Neutral colors like beige, cream, and white harmonize well with grey. Combining grey with light neutrals creates a clean, elegant, versatile, and timeless look. You can opt for a monochromatic outfit with shades of grey and accents of white or beige to achieve a sophisticated and modern aesthetic.

Silver With Grey

Grey and silver create a chic and futuristic pairing. Metallic silver accents, such as silver jewelry or accessories, can enhance the coolness of grey clothing and add a touch of glamour. Green With Grey

Green, especially shades like mint or sage green, can provide a refreshing and nature-inspired complement to grey. This combination works well for casual and relaxed outfits, creating a harmonious and calming effect. You can incorporate green through accessories like scarves, bags, or shoes to add a pop of color to your grey ensemble.

Bold Color Combinations

Yellow With Grey

Yellow and grey create a vibrant and energetic pairing. Bright shades of yellow, such as lemon or mustard yellow, can add a cheerful and playful touch to grey clothing. This combination works well during the warmer seasons and can be incorporated through accessories or statement pieces like a yellow handbag or shoes.

Red With Grey

Red is a bold and striking color that can create a powerful contrast with grey. Whether it's a vibrant red dress paired with a grey blazer or red accessories combined with a grey outfit, this combination exudes confidence and makes a fashion statement. Red is particularly well-suited for formal events or when you want to stand out from the crowd.

Purple With Grey

Purple and grey create a luxurious and regal pairing. Dark shades of purple, such as eggplant or plum, can add depth and richness to grey clothing. This combination is perfect for evening wear or special occasions when you want to exude elegance and sophistication.

Tips for Styling Grey Clothing

Creating a different and gorgeous look is all about being creative. Let's see, how can you create a style unique with a different outfit:

Experiment with Different Shades of Grey

Grey comes in a variety of shades, ranging from light to dark. Experimenting with different shades of grey can add depth and dimension to your outfit. Pairing lighter shades of grey with darker ones can create a visually exciting and dynamic look. For example, combining a light grey top with charcoal grey pants or a dark grey jacket can create a stylish contrast.

Consider Texture and Fabric

When styling grey clothing, it's essential to consider the texture and fabric of the garments. Grey fabrics with interesting textures like tweed, knit, or satin can add visual interest and elevate your outfit. Additionally, mixing different fabric textures can create a visually pleasing combination. For instance, pairing a soft, cashmere grey sweater with a sleek, grey leather skirt can create a chic and modern ensemble.

Use Prints and Patterns

Adding prints and patterns to your grey clothing can instantly liven up your look. Prints like stripes, polka dots, and floral or geometric patterns can add a playful and eye-catching element to your outfit. Consider incorporating a patterned accessory like a scarf, handbag, or statement shoes to add color and pattern to your grey ensemble.

Pay Attention to Contrast

Contrast is essential when styling grey clothing. Pairing grey with colors that create a distinct contrast can make your outfit stand out. For example, pairing a light grey blouse with black pants or a dark grey skirt with a crisp white shirt can create a striking and sophisticated contrast. Balancing the contrast is essential to ensure a visually pleasing and cohesive look.

Use Accessories Wisely

Accessories play a crucial role in enhancing your grey outfits. They can add color, texture, and personality to your overall look. Opt for accessories in complementary or contrasting colors to create visual interest. For example, a bold red handbag or a vibrant yellow scarf can inject energy into a grey outfit. Additionally, metallic accessories like silver or gold jewelry can add a touch of glamour and sophistication.

Consider the Occasion and Season

The occasion and season should also influence your color choices when styling grey clothing. Pairing grey with neutral tones like white, black, or beige for formal events or professional settings can create a polished and elegant look. On the other hand, for casual outings or during the warmer seasons, you can experiment with bolder and brighter colors like coral, turquoise, or lime green to create a more playful and summery vibe.
